#E96908 Hex Color Code

#E96908

The Hexadecimal Color #E96908 is a contrast shade of Chocolate. #E96908 RGB value is rgb(233, 105, 8). RGB Color Model of #E96908 consists of 91% red, 41% green and 3% blue. HSL color Mode of #E96908 has 26°(degrees) Hue, 93% Saturation and 47% Lightness. #E96908 color has an wavelength of 603.62963nm approximately. The nearest Web Safe Color of #E96908 is #FF9933. The Closest Small Hexadecimal Code of #E96908 is #E60. The Closest Color to #E96908 is #D2691E. Official Name of #E96908 Hex Code is Clementine. CMYK (Cyan Magenta Yellow Black) of #E96908 is 0 Cyan 55 Magenta 97 Yellow 9 Black and #E96908 CMY is 0, 55, 97. HSLA (Hue Saturation Lightness Alpha) of #E96908 is hsl(26,93,47, 1.0) and HSV is hsv(26, 97, 91). A Three-Dimensional XYZ value of #E96908 is 38.7, 27.45, 3.49.
Hex8 Value of #E96908 is #E96908FF. Decimal Value of #E96908 is 15296776 and Octal Value of #E96908 is 72264410. Binary Value of #E96908 is 11101001, 1101001, 1000 and Android of #E96908 is 4293486856 / 0xffe96908. The Horseshoe Shaped Chromaticity Diagram xyY of #E96908 is 0.556, 0.394, 0.394 and YIQ Color Space of #E96908 is 132.214, 107.4413, -3.1144. The Color Space LMS (Long Medium Short) of #E96908 is 39.59, 19.39, 3.92. CieLAB (L*a*b*) of #E96908 is 59.39, 45.64, 66.45. CieLUV : LCHuv (L*, u*, v*) of #E96908 is 59.39, 106.55, 52.22. The cylindrical version of CieLUV is known as CieLCH : LCHab of #E96908 is 59.39, 80.61, 55.52. Hunter Lab variable of #E96908 is 52.39, 40.16, 32.73.

Triad, Tetrad and SplitComplement of #E96908

Triad, Tetrad, and Split Complement are hex color schemes used in art to create harmonious combinations of colors.

The Triad color scheme involves three colors that are evenly spaced around the color wheel, forming an equilateral triangle. The primary triad includes red, blue, and yellow, while other triadic combinations can be formed with different hues. Triad color schemes offer a balanced contrast and are versatile for creating vibrant and dynamic visuals.

The Tetrad color scheme incorporates four colors that are arranged in two complementary pairs. These pairs create a rectangle or square shape on the color wheel. The primary Tetrad includes two sets of complementary colors, such as red and green, and blue and orange. This scheme provides a wide range of color options and allows for both strong contrast and harmonious blends.

The Split Complement color scheme involves a base color paired with the two colors adjacent to its complementary color on the color wheel. For example, if the base color is blue, the Split Complement scheme would include blue, yellow-orange, and red-orange. This combination maintains contrast while offering a more subtle and balanced alternative to a complementary color scheme.
